What does it look like to trust God when life feels desperate? In this message from 2 Kings 6–7, Stephen Davey walks through some of the most dramatic and surprising events in Elisha’s ministry. From a floating axe head to an invisible army to the deliverance of a starving city, you’ll see God’s power on display in both personal struggles and national crises.

You’ll meet a servant whose eyes are opened to spiritual reality, a prophet who stays calm under siege, and four lepers who become messengers of salvation. And you’ll discover that God never stops working, even when all seems lost.

Whether you’re dealing with small frustrations or overwhelming fear, this episode will remind you: God sees you, He knows your need, and His mercy is never out of reach.
